Ticket: Staging env misconfigured for Siftgate bloom filter

The bloom layer in front of the Pellet KV store is rejecting all lookups in staging because the env file was copied from the dev template without credentials. False-positive tuning values are fine; only the auth line is missing. To unblock the weekly demo, the Pellet admission secret must be set on the following line.

env line for yaguf-fajop: LEDGER_TOKEN13=fb08984397349

## Sweeper Cadence

The Brindlewood retention sweeper walks each tenant partition nightly and deletes rows past their retention class. If the sweeper falls behind, it does not catch up automatically; it simply resumes at the next scheduled window. On-call should watch the `sweep_lag_hours` gauge and page only if two consecutive windows are missed. Batch sizes and pause intervals were chosen to keep replica lag under a second. The current tuning constants are listed below.

tuning constants:
QUOTAS = {
    "druwyn": 5,
    "holix": 5,
    "zorath": 5,
    "holwyn": 10,
}

**Onboarding: The Glimmerfeed Stale-Cache Incident**

New folks at Pendrell Systems should read the Glimmerfeed postmortem carefully. In short: a cache key omitted the locale segment, so users in the Varnmouth region saw week-old pricing for three days. The fix added locale to every key and a TTL audit job. When reviewing the postmortem archive, you'll be prompted to unlock the incident vault; use the recovery passphrase listed below:

unlock words, kadug-tahog: casax-holath